    Analysis of the Energy Transition through Electrification Scenarios in the Ecuadorian Shrimp Farming Sector

    Get PDF
    The shrimp sector in Ecuador is the second most important in the country and has begun a process of energy transition through the electrification of its operations, moving from the use of diesel for pumping water and aerating the farming ponds, towards the connection to the electrical grid. This energy transition leads to investments in infrastructure and generates an impact on different variables of the sector, such as its productivity, exports, greenhouse gas emissions, social impacts, among others. This study develops a methodology to analyze the energy transition of the sector through electrification scenarios.     Digitalization of School Education - Understanding the Pains and Gains of Students and Teachers in Berlin: A Qualitative Analysis Regarding the COVID-19 Pandemic.

    No full text
    The global pandemic of the COVID-19 virus had an immense impact on various industries around the world. The education sector is just one among many where disruptive changes were implemented overnight. Most schools in Berlin switched to a virtual learning environment, called saLzH (schulisches angeleitetes Lernen zu Hause) without having time to prepare either students or teachers for the new situation. Although the gap between actual digital resources in Berlin’s schools and a functioning digital education infrastructure had previously been addressed by the DigitalPakt Schule, the situation was perceived difficult by all relevant stakeholder groups for various reasons. In this thesis, exploratory interviews of five students and five teachers are analyzed with a focus on identifying the pains and gains of each of those two groups with regards to digitalization of school education. The major gains of students identified here are: time flexibility, having more time for hobbies, less time spent commuting, independent learning, being motivated by digital tools, being able to learn at own pace, feeling more comfortable at home, having less pressure on oral performance, being more productive, increasing their media competency, increased teamwork, and learning transparency. The major pains of students identified here are: difficulties understanding new topics, dealing with technical issues, being distanced from their friends, and in general a dependence of their learning outcomes on the following factors: individual gadget availability, ability to learn independently, concentration span, social situation at home, and financial situation at home. The major gains of teachers with regards to teaching are: being able to provide differentiated tasks, and an increased learning transparency; personal gains of teachers are the acquisition of new skills, and an increased time flexibility. The major pains of teachers are: not being able to reach certain students (due to lack of gadgets / parents’ motivation), having to leave some students behind, more pressure due to constant availability / communication, an increased stress level, the pressure to learn new tools, having to rely on personal gadgets, and extra workload due to analogue and digital teaching simultaneously
